Get yourself a good water bottle to bring to school. You need to be hydrated all day. This is especially important if you have several classes back-to-back and don’t have time to eat. You will be able to remain focused and alert if you drink water during the day. You can refill water bottles at many different water fountains.

Your environment can make all the difference in the world when it comes to studying successfully. The best location for your studies isn’t always your dorm. Instead, seek out a place that’s quiet and isn’t full of distractions. The school library is always a good choice. If you have to study in the dorm, get yourself some headphones.

Make sure you are aware of the campus security number. Campus police always have an easy number to remember or places around campus in which you can call them at a push of a button. With any luck, that information will be unnecessary, but it is smart to have it just in case.

Pack only the essentials to reduce clutter in your dorm. Dorm rooms are small and can fill with clutter very quickly. Write out a basic list of what you need and then shop strictly within it. Look for space-saving storage that saves you space and designs that are compact.
